Well known as a modern fiction writer with remarkable creative energy and keen insight into existential issues. Marzboom is a important novel. In the novel, there is a glimpse of all the events of the current India, by which the "new identity" of our country and nation is being established. In it, the changing but distorted faces of politics, economy, judiciary, army, police, religious fanaticism and media can be seen. Forcedly built temples, illegal occupation of other people's houses, land and ponds, people becoming cautious and afraid of questions, self-confidence in women's attitudes, backwardness of the country, romance of trade.
